On January 10, 1997, the State of Texas received federal approval of the Coastal Management Program (CMP) (62 Federal Register pp. 1439 - 1440). Under federal law, federal agency activities and actions affecting the Texas coastal zone must be consistent with the CMP goals and policies identified in 31 TAC Chapter 26. Requests for federal consistency review were deemed administratively complete for the following project(s) during the period of March 17, 2025 to April 4, 2025. As required by federal law, the public is given an opportunity to comment on the consistency of proposed activities in the coastal zone undertaken or authorized by federal agencies. Pursuant to 31 TAC §§30.20(f), 30.30(h), and 30.40(e), the public comment period extends 30 days from the date published on the Texas General Land Office web site. The notice was published on the web site on Friday, April 11, 2025. The public comment period for this project will close at 5:00 p.m. on Sunday, May 11, 2025.
Federal License and Permit Activities:
Applicant: Dustin Seafood
Location: The project site is located in the Sabine River, at 5500 South 1st Avenue, in Port Arthur, Jefferson County, Texas.
Latitude and Longitude: 29.7380305, -93.8875261
Project Description: The applicant proposes to excavate 5,627 cubic yards (CY) of sandy, non-vegetated material via mechanical dredging to a maximum depth of -10.22 feet mean high water around existing boat slips in an area measuring 20,674-square-foot. The project would include installation of 590 linear feet of new steel bulkhead along an existing bulkhead and filling 4,233-square-foot (0.10 acre) of an abandoned boat slip with approximately 705 CY of material. All dredged material will be placed onsite in uplands and stockpiled until dewatered, then spread and compacted in upland area. Maintenance dredging would occur every five years and remove approximately 2,000 CY of material per dredge cycle. The applicant has not proposed compensatory mitigation.
Type of Application: U.S. Army Corps of Engineers permit application # SWG-2024-00788. This application will be reviewed pursuant to Section 10 of the Rivers and Harbors Act of 1899 and Section 404 of the Clean Water Act. Note: The consistency review for this project may be conducted by the Texas Commission on Environmental Quality as part of its certification under §401 of the Clean Water Act.
CMP Project No: 25-1164-F1
